I have a 2002 honda civic lx 1.7 L with 97K clicks, since last 2 months the engine is making more noise and gives a bit of vibration on raise and feels as if it is strugling (during acceleration in particular between 1500-3000 rpm), once past 3000 rpm the car drives smooth. I changed the spark plugs it still did not helped. any suggestions?

What kind of noise are you getting? Is it more like an exhaust system noise? I would take some time to check the exhaust system. Drive the car up on a ramp and with the help of a friend have them hold a rag over the tailpipe to temporarily plug the pipe. You should be under the car noting where any exhaust leaks are. Start with that and while under there, examine the heat shields on the exhaust as well for any of them that might be loose.
